Plain-English summary
Department of Defense Talent Management Improvement Act of 2017
This bill suspends for FY2018-FY2022 the fiscal year limit on the number of: (1) commissioned officers serving on active duty in the Army, Air Force, Marine Corps, or Navy; or (2) officers on active duty Reserve or full-time National Guard duty.
